In a new qualitative initiative, the President of Al-Furat Al-Awsat Technical University, Prof. Dr. Mudhaffar Sadiq Al-Zuhairy, opened a literacy eradication course organized by the Continuing Education Center at the University Presidency.
Al-Zuhairy, during his attendance, inaugurated the course by welcoming the female and male participants who participated in it, giving them the title of “elite” for the services they provide and the good effort they make in serving the university.
The President of the University stressed in his speech the importance of learning to read and write to achieve the comprehensive development of the individual and society, citing the Holy Verses and what was narrated about the righteous predecessors. He considered this initiative one of the important educational initiatives adopted by the University Presidency, pointing out that eradicating illiteracy represents eradicating ignorance, poverty and backwardness, especially since illiteracy is one of the most important challenges facing societies.
In conclusion, Dr. Al-Zuhairy expressed his wishes for success for all participants in the course, stressing that learning is the path to progress, a better future and achieving success at the personal and professional levels.
Al-Zuhairy called on all female and male workers in the university to take advantage of the available educational opportunities and participate in future educational initiatives.
It is noted that the course lasts for a month, and more than 25 workers from the university service staff participated in it.
This course comes within the university’s quest to develop its employees’ skills and enable them to actively participate in the education and development process. This course also marks the beginning of a series of future initiatives that the university will take in the field of education and literacy eradication.
